About The Position

The Vice President Product Manager for Global Equity Compensation and Workplace Wealth Initiatives at Morgan Stanley will be responsible for shaping and delivering digital experiences across web and mobile for Morgan Stanley at Work clients and their employees globally. This role involves product discovery, execution excellence, and strong risk and control partnership to deliver a best-in-class workplace wealth journey. The individual will help create best-in-class experiences for corporate clients and their employees, ranging from private to public companies and from small businesses to global enterprise leaders. Morgan Stanley is a leading global financial services firm providing a wide range of investment banking, securities, investment management, and wealth management services, serving clients worldwide from more than 1,200 offices in 43 countries. The firm is committed to helping its employees build meaningful careers. In the Wealth Management division, the goal is to help people, businesses, and institutions build, preserve, and manage wealth. The WM Platforms team manages industry-leading platforms across all WM channels and client segments to provide a unified digital experience, unlock growth, and deliver efficiencies for Advisors, Clients, and Institutions. This team consists of ten sub-teams.

Requirements

  • 7+ years of experience in a product owner/manager/analyst capacity or related product role.
  • Financial acumen: deep knowledge of financial domains, such as payments, global trading, banking infrastructure, global equity plan management.
  • Ability to use SQL and other data analytics tools to derive insights from vast financial datasets, track KPIs, and understand user behavior to drive data driven decision making.
  • Technical literacy in high level architecture principles, API design and data modeling.
  • High empathy, with a focus on strong user experience to simplify complex workflows.
  • Agile mastery, with proficiency in Scrum, Agile, and Kanban, with an ability to adapt to processes in large, complex organizations.
  • Familiarity with emerging trends in technology.
  • Proficient in use of Gen AI tools, understanding of LLMs, and application in product development.
  • High inter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to build relationships and influence across large organizations.
  • Ability to develop compelling product strategy and deliver solutions with strong written communication and technical writing.

Responsibilities

  • Define and deliver key features as part of the Global Equity Compensation and Workplace Wealth digital strategy through delivery of online and mobile customer experience enhancements.
  • Oversee projects from initial market discovery and requirement gathering (PRDs/User Stories) to successful go-to-market (GTM) launches and post-launch iteration.
  • Contribute to strategic, executive-ready materials that support decision-making with clear roadmaps, value based metrics, risks, and investment needs.
  • Work with cross-functional technology teams (product, user experience, technology) to design and deliver new products, features, and enhancements.
  • Write clear product requirements (PRDs, epics, and user stories) including business rules, acceptance criteria, and edge cases to integrate equity compensation experiences.
  • Partner with legal, risk, and compliance teams to ensure products adhere to global regulations and maintain a sound risk posture.
  • Define and track success metrics to effectively manage product profitability, including budgeting, cost optimization, and tracking ROI for new features developed.
